Expect restricted water supply – NWSDB

The National Water Supply and Drainage Board (NWSDB) stated water supply will have to be restricted as water sources in many areas have dried up due to the prevailing dry weather.
It announced that the 24-hour uninterrupted water supply would be limited and that there would be less pressure on the water supply to consumers in the highland areas.
The NWSDB, in a press release, also urged consumers to use water sparingly in the face of the dry weather.
